The company is selecting a Mission Analysis and Navigation Engineer to be integrated in the Interplanetary Mission Analysis and Navigation Competence Centre of the Mission engineering Business Unit.
The work of the Mission Engineering Business Unit is oriented to supporting the design of space missions from a mission analysis point of view (for both ESA and commercial customers), design software tools for mission analysis studies and do research in celestial mechanics and astrodynamics.
As a matter of reference, current activities comprise:
−Interplanetary missions (planets, astronomy, minor bodies, etc.)
−Earth observation and lunar missions
−Flight dynamics
−SW Development
−Planetary Defence
−Formation flying
−Autonomous in-orbit rendezvous
−Space transportation systems and re-entry vehicles
−Planetary entry, descent and landing

The following types of responsibilities are envisioned:
▪Support to mission analysis and design for interplanetary and Earth missions
▪Development of software tools in support to mission analysis actions
▪Performance of covariance and navigation assessments
▪Development of software for navigation purposes
▪Design, optimize, and automate orbit manoeuvre strategies and algorithms for constellation deployment, station-keeping, replenishment, collision avoidance, and re-entry.
▪Modelling and simulation of space systems, including space environment and space vehicle dynamics
▪Play an active role in fostering the consolidation of the engineering processes and promoting technology research, innovation and development actions
